HOW SEXUAL ENERGY AFFECTS RELATIONSHIPS: EXPLORING ITS IMPACT ON SELFWORTH AND VALUE enIT FR DE PL TR PT RU JA CN ES

The topic of how sexual energy influences the perception of self-worth and relational value is an intriguing one that has been studied extensively by scholars and experts alike. It is important to understand this concept because it can have significant implications for individual well-being and interpersonal dynamics.

Sexual energy refers to the physical and emotional drive toward sexual activity and desire. This energy can be expressed through various means such as flirting, touching, kissing, and sexual intercourse. It is often associated with feelings of excitement, pleasure, and intimacy, and it can also play a role in shaping how individuals perceive their own worth and value within relationships.

Those who experience high levels of sexual energy may feel more confident and desirable, while those with low levels of sexual energy may feel less attractive or valued.

When it comes to self-worth, studies have shown that individuals who are sexually active tend to have higher levels of self-esteem than those who are not. This is likely due to the fact that engaging in sexual activities can lead to increased feelings of confidence, empowerment, and satisfaction.

Individuals who feel sexually satisfied and desired may feel more secure and valued in their relationships. On the other hand, those who do not experience regular or satisfying sexual encounters may struggle with self-doubt and insecurity, which can negatively impact their overall sense of self-worth.

In terms of relational value, sexual energy can play a complex role. While some individuals may use sexual energy to strengthen their bonds with partners, others may become dependent on it to maintain a relationship. This dependence can be problematic if one partner's level of sexual energy is significantly different from the other's, leading to frustration, resentment, or even infidelity. In addition, individuals who prioritize sexual activity over emotional connection may struggle to build lasting and meaningful relationships, as true intimacy requires both physical and emotional investment.

Sexual energy is an important aspect of human experience that can greatly influence how we view ourselves and our relationships. By understanding this concept and recognizing its potential pitfalls, individuals can work toward healthier and more fulfilling connections with themselves and others.
